Our Polyacrylic Acid Sizing Agent RG-SF is precisely formulated as a dedicated water jet loom sizing agent for polyester. Its unique composition provides the necessary lubrication and film strength to the polyester filament yarn, allowing it to withstand the intense friction and tension inherent in high-speed water jet weaving. This results in significantly fewer yarn breakages, reduced machine stops, and ultimately, a substantial improvement in overall loom efficiency and productivity.


The seamless integration of RG-SF into the sizing process is another key advantage. It is suitable for use at normal temperatures and can be applied either singly or in combination with starch, offering flexibility to textile mills.
